New Zealand Government endorses Vodafone as an official supplier of telecommunications services

MEDIA RELEASE - Vodafone has won a significant endorsement from the New Zealand Government, now named an official supplier in telecommunications services.

For over 18 months Vodafone has worked on a suite of innovative telecommunications services designed to enable government agencies to better engage with an increasingly digital public.

Vodafone’s Ready Government proposition offers a range of standardised, “as a service” solutions across mobile communications, site connectivity, contact centre operations and service aggregation.

Vodafone is a member of the government’s new Telecommunications as a Service (TaaS) panel, designed to provide a range of cross-government telecommunications services sourced from a competitive, innovative market which are easy for agencies to access, and assist them to provide better customer services.

The TaaS panel is administered by the Government Chief Information Officer at the Department of Internal Affairs, and reflects the goals of the Government ICT Strategy and Action Plan.

Vodafone Ready Government will be available through the Government’s TaaS service catalogue.
